Title: An EAL/D handbook :teaching and learning across the curriculum when English is an additional language or dialect /edited by Helen Harper and Susan Feez. Location: 428.24 PET Added Name: Harper, Helen, (editor.). Feez, Susan, (editor.). Series: PETAA ;; 125 Subject: Language & Linguistics. Education. SUBJECT: Australian Awards Note: Highly Commended Educational Publishing Awards Australia 2021 for the Primary: Reference Resource category ISBN: 9781925132595 Collation: 182 pages ; 25 cm. Summary Note: "In this book, readers are invited into seven classrooms, where teachers share illustrations of practice designed to enable EAL/D learners to engage with curriculum.
